On July 4th Travis put down the BBQ and fireworks to attend a life changing event, "A Call to Ceremony for the Navajo People” hosted by guests Colette LeGarrigues and Andrew Forsthoefel. In the presence of Andrew’s mystifying and powerful connection to the Navajo People and his Diné mentor Daryl - Travis, Colette and Andrew discuss:

Navajo Medicine
The meaning of "ceremony"
COVID 19 and Navajo Nation
Indigenous experience in America
Race in America
Feeling the grief of our past
Spirituality as willing to listen
And more!

Navajo and Hopi Families COVID-19 Relief is a volunteer grassroots indiginous-led initiative that organizes volunteers to safely deliver groceries, water, and health supplies to those hardest hit. The initiative prioritizes the elderly (especially those raising grandchildren), single, parents, and struggling families.

Navajo Water Project is a community-managed utility alternative that brings hot and cold running water to homes without access to sewer lines (more than one-third of households in Navajo Nation do not have running water).

The Orenda Tribe COVID 19 Response is a grassroots initiative working to bring immediate aid to those in need on the Navajo Nation. They prioritize efficient ordering and daily deliveries of PPE, food and firewood.

Andrew Forsthoefel is a writer, speaker, and group facilitator living in southern Vermont. His memoir "Walking to Listen" tells the story of his year-long walk across America in 2011. Now, he delivers keynotes and holds workshops on the role of trustworthy listening as a catalyst for the transformation of trauma, ignorance, and violence at the personal and collective levels.
